Method
Preparation
Prepare the Tater Tots
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). Spread the tater tots on a baking sheet in a single layer and bake for 20-25 minutes, or until golden brown and crispy. Stir halfway through for even cooking.
Cook the Ground Brisket
In a large skillet over medium heat, add the ground brisket. Use a wooden spoon to break it apart as it cooks. Season with salt, black pepper, garlic powder, and onion powder. Cook until well browned and fully cooked, about 8-10 minutes.
Assembling the Wrap
Combine Ingredients
In a large mixing bowl, combine the cooked ground brisket, baked tater tots, cheddar jack cheese, and queso. Mix until well combined.
Fill the Tortillas
Lay a flour tortilla flat on a clean surface. Spoon a generous portion of the filling mixture onto the center of the tortilla. Be careful not to overfill.
Wrap the Tortilla
Fold the sides of the tortilla inward, then roll it from the bottom up to encase the filling. Repeat with the remaining tortillas.
Cooking the Wraps
Toast the Wraps
In the same skillet used for the brisket, place the wraps seam-side down. Toast over medium heat for about 2-3 minutes until golden brown. Flip and toast the other side for another 2-3 minutes.
Serving
Serve the Wraps
Cut each wrap in half and serve warm. Optionally, top with sour cream, chopped green onions, and sliced jalapeños.
